Updates: Burst water main, Stanmore

Stanmore flood

We are aware of burst water mains affecting Uxbridge Road, Stanmore. Updates will be provided on this page as and when we receive them.

Friday 18 July 1pm

Road closures remain in place while damage to the road and footway is assessed. The closure will be in place over the weekend and re-assessed on Monday. 

This affects the area near Masefield Avenue and Chartley Avenue

Some properties have reported water damage - please follow advice from Affinity Water. You can see updates from Affinity Water

They are in the process of cleaning the carriageway, footways and driveways at the moment.

 

Friday 18 July 9.30am

This morning we were alerted to a burst water main affecting Uxbridge Road, Stanmore. Our engineers are on site with the London Fire Brigade and Affinity Water.  There is significant damage to the road and footways, repairs will be carried out as soon as our partners Affinity Water have repaired the burst water mains. 

Road closures are in place, please follow diversions.

Some residents may have missed bin collections due to the closures. We are waiting for further information to assess the situation and an update will be provided on when services will resume.
